Transaction 3fa50ba9e71bc7265f7159d0aa1e94a4295af03e7f7282227436b33e32f1d5ee

block
6659894ee995520d40d2e6e04a1026d22af53db073b87a21a07f40571c9b8601

1 Input

2 Outputs